Uncharted: The Nathan Drake Collection Drops On October 9

We all assumed it was coming at some point, right?

Sony has announced the collection fans have all been waiting for: Uncharted: The Nathan Drake Collection , which will launch on October 9 for PlayStation 4.

As you might expect, this package will include Uncharted: Drake's Fortune , Uncharted 2: Among Thieves , and Uncharted 3: Drake's Deception . Bluepoint Games is working on the compilation and they've got a solid history of issuing remastered releases. They'll bring us 1080p and 60 frames per second for each of the three titles, and we'll enjoy "better lighting, textures, and models." Plus, we'll get a Photo Mode and new Trophies.

Pre-ordering this bad boy nets you the Nathan Drake Pack, which boasts single-player skins of iconic Drake outfits and a couple awesome Golden weapons. You'll even get the Nathan Drake Collection PS4 dynamic theme. Just buying the collection will give you exclusive access to the multiplayer beta for Uncharted 4: A Thief's End but we're not sure when that will be just yet. Maybe end of 2015…?
